Collector Saeed Jadoon reshuffles 15 officers from all sections

ISLAMABAD: Newly appointed Collector Dr. Saeed Khan Jadoon of Model Customs Collectorate (MCC) Islamabad transferred 14 Superintendents and an Appraiser from all sections working under MCC Islamabad.

According to details given by sources of MCC Islamabad that the Collector MCC Islamabad ordered the transfers of the above said 01 Appraiser and 14th Superintends.
The sources said the superintendents, who were transferred from different places, comprise of Superintendents ASO Islamabad Zargham Dil and Rana Shakeel who have been posted at International Mail Office (IMO) while Nasir Barlas was transferred from ASO to Exports Section of Air Freight Unit (AFU), Arif Dar transferred from ASO to Law Branch and Superintendent Tariq Awan was transferred from ASO to Customs Security Offices (CSO).
Sources told CT that Superintendent Shaheen has been transferred from ASO to Recovery Section whereas Superintendent Ahmed Junaid is transferred from Airport to Preventive Department while Sohail Quraishi is transferred from Dry Port Islamabad to State Ware House Islamabad. Superintendent Gul Muhammad has been transferred from Unaccompanied Baggage (UAB) to Dry Port Islamabad.
Superintendent Ali Ayaz is reshuffled from AFU to Dry Port Islamabad while Javed Ishaque has been transferred  from Bond Section to ASO Islamabad and Superintendent HS Ali done from Bond Section to Airport Islamabad. Superintendent Chaudhry Iftikhar has been transferred from Law Branch to I&P Section whereas Appraiser Israr Hussain, who was working at AFU, doned to Auction Cell.
The collector is hopeful of good performance with the reshuffling at the Collectorate.
